Women Preparing Sashimi

Kitagawa Utamaro

The Metropolitan Museum of Art

Two women in traditional Japanese clothing, kimonos, are shown in a domestic setting. The woman in the foreground is crouched down, holding a large knife and cutting raw fish on a red tray. A low table with a large plate of raw fish sits beside her. The woman behind her sits on the floor, her left leg bent under her, and holds a cloth. Both women have dark hair styled in traditional Japanese fashion, adorned with hairpins. The woman in front wears a brown kimono with red and white designs; the woman behind wears a brown kimono with black and red trim over a patterned under-kimono. A small, vertically written text and a ruler for scale are on the right side. The background is a plain beige color.
